What Is Pityriasis rosea

This is one possible rash diagnpsis give to me for my spots. It usually begins with the ‘herald patch’ but not always. Then there are spots on trunk and extremieties that develop. Though it’s said to be a young person’s rash, I know people in their fifties and sixties with this diagnosis. Remember that with a rash there are classic symptoms but there are many people who do not have them as well. You may not have the herald patch, but you can still have pityriasis rosea.
The analysis of the cause varies. Some say it is a type of
herpes virus- ie number 7. Others attribute it to a virus and still a nother group of experts think it is a drug related rash.
If you are someone who is uncomfortable by the itching they recommend steroid creams and antihistamines. Though some have the classical look of the christmas tree branches and hearald patch that announces the rash, others don’t . It may look like eczema, psoriasis , erythema multiforme or a fungus rash so try to get a biopsy if you can to narrow it down. this will help you learn if it’s contagious and also which meds will treat it best.
Some people will have a respiratory infection. The duration can be a few weeks to a few months before it resolves. It is more common in females than males. Zinc oxide can be helpful as an external treatment. It is not viewed as contagious which is a relief to many suffering from it. To add that fear on top of a skin problem that may take months to resolve makes human interactions quite difficult. One doesn’t want to pass it on to another . Yet isolation during a rash can be quite difficult.
Sunlight can be helpful for some, but sometimes heat can be a problem. Warm rather than hot showers are advised as well as a mild soap. It seems to be seasonal and there is higher incidence in the fall and spring than other seasons.
